Chocolate and Vanilla Rice Pudding Recipe

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up white rice
  • 2 cups water
  • 1 1/2 cups milk
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1/4 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ips

Instructions:

  1. In a large saucepan, mix together rice, water, milk, cream, sugar, vanilla extract, and salt. Bring to a boil over medium-high heat.
  2. Reduce heat to low and simmer until most of the liquid has been absorbed by the rice, stirring occasionally, for about 20 minutes.
  3. Add the cocoa powder and chocolate chips and stir to combine. Cook for an additional 5 minutes until fully melted and combined.
  4. If the pudding is too thick, add additional milk or cream until desired consistency is reached.
  5. Serve hot or cold, garnished with fresh berries or whipped cream if desired.
